The FurnCIRCLE project has officially released the "Handbook for Facilitating the Circular Economy Transition in the EU Furniture Industry", marking a major step forward in supporting the European furniture sector’s transition toward circularity. Available in 10 EU languages, the handbook is the result of a collaborative effort led by AMBIT, FLA, and EFIC, with technical support from Nutcreatives. Its development involved a broad consortium of FurnCIRCLE partners—including industry associations, research centres, and innovation-driven organisations—who worked closely with external experts to create a strategic and practical tool for the sector.
At a time of increasing environmental and economic complexity, the handbook responds to the urgent need for a shift to more sustainable business models. It offers a deep dive into the principles of the circular economy, contrasting it with the traditional linear approach, and introduces the CANVAS business model as a foundation for circular transformation.
The guide outlines the current state of the European furniture industry—an economic heavyweight generating over €100 billion annually—highlighting both its strengths and its environmental challenges. It addresses key topics such as design for circularity, material efficiency, life cycle thinking, and environmental impact assessments.
Notably, the handbook presents 30 actionable design and lifecycle strategies and showcases hundreds of real-world examples to inspire implementation. It also reviews relevant EU sustainability legislation, providing companies with the necessary context to align with evolving regulatory demands.
To further enhance its practical and strategic value, the handbook includes sections such as “Skills, Needs and Recommendations”, which address the workforce competencies essential for enabling the circular transition. It also features a comprehensive Annex that brings together a repository of validated good practices and business cases, an overview of the FurnCIRCLE Self-Assessment Tool to determine a company’s level of circular maturity, testimonial videos from companies that participated in the tool’s validation, and a detailed report on the pilot phase of the self-assessment tool. Together, these components make the handbook not only a strategic guide but also a hands-on resource for companies across the European furniture industry.
